 The article is devoted to the effective applications of the superposition principle in teaching physics and mathematics. In the process of teaching any subject, including physics and mathematics, it is necessary to pay due attention to the general ideas and principles applying to almost all sections of the course. Sequential study of the principles not only contributes to a complete understanding of the subject, but also makes it possible to transform and apply the skills acquired in one section in the process of teaching another section. Moreover, sometimes such opportunities arise not only at the intra-subject level, but also at the inter-subject level, when an idea or principle taken from the “source” of one subject can, in a certain sense, be applied in teaching another subject. The search and realization of such opportunities can promote the development of interdisciplinary connections and teaching quality.

In this work, after a general presentation of the main idea of the superposition principle, its specific applications in electrodynamics are considered. A set of electrostatics problems are presented, the solutions of which are accompanied by methodological instructions. Possible options for posing other similar problems of electrodynamics are also indicated. Trying to establish certain similarities, the ideas of this principle are applied in the process of solving some problems in a mathematics course, which is the main scientific and methodological novelty of the work.
